The Right Fork Little Kanawha River is a small river in central West Virginia, United States. It is about 14.1 miles (22.7 km) long. This river is a branch, or tributary, of the Little Kanawha River.
The Right Fork Little Kanawha River is part of a much larger watershed. A watershed is an area of land where all the water drains into one main river or body of water. This river's water eventually flows into the Ohio River and then into the mighty Mississippi River. It helps drain an area of 37.6 square miles (97 km2) of rural land.
Where the River Flows
The Right Fork Little Kanawha River starts in the southeastern part of Upshur County. This is about 4 miles (6.4 km) west of a town called Helvetia.
From its start, the river generally flows towards the west. It forms part of the border between Upshur and Webster counties. Then, it continues along the border between Lewis and Webster counties.
As it flows, the river passes through a small community named Cleveland. Near its end, it goes through a tiny part of eastern Braxton County.
Finally, the Right Fork Little Kanawha River flows into the Little Kanawha River. This happens near the border of Braxton and Lewis counties. It's about 2 miles (3.2 km) southwest of the community of Wildcat.
Other Streams
One interesting stream that joins the Right Fork is called the Left Fork Right Fork Little Kanawha River. Yes, that's a long name! It means it's a "left branch" of the "right branch" of the Little Kanawha River.
This Left Fork flows west for about 7.1 miles (11.4 km). It runs through the southern part of Upshur County before joining the Right Fork.
